Position Overview
The Senior Accountant will play a central role in maintaining the integrity of financial information and ensuring compliance with internal controls and accounting standards. This individual will collaborate closely with cross‑functional teams, support audits, and contribute to process improvements that enhance efficiency and accuracy.
Key Responsibilities
• Manage month‑end, quarter‑end, and year‑end close processes, including journal entries, reconciliations, and variance analysis
• Prepare and review financial statements in accordance with GAAP
• Maintain and reconcile general ledger accounts, ensuring accuracy and completeness
• Support internal and external audits by providing schedules, documentation, and explanations
• Analyze financial data to identify trends, discrepancies, and opportunities for improvement
• Assist with budgeting and forecasting activities
• Develop and implement process improvements to streamline accounting workflows
• Ensure compliance with company policies, accounting standards, and regulatory requirements
• Collaborate with operational teams to provide financial insights and support decision‑making
